Windows Application Developer

NewGen

$90K — $120K *
Information Technology
Less than 5 years of experience
Job Overview by Ladders

Qualifications

  • TS/SCI FSP Clearance is required
  • 3 years of experience with C, C++, and Python for development, testing, and debugging
  • In-depth experience with Windows OS software development using Visual Studio IDE and Windows SDK
  • Strong understanding of Windows low-level systems development and APIs
  • 3 years of professional software development experience, including design and debugging
  • Experience with software configuration management tools like Git
  • Knowledge of OS internals in BSD/Linux/Unix, Windows, Mac OS, Android, or RISC assembly

Responsibilities

  • Develop and debug applications for Windows platforms
  • Test and validate software functionality and performance
  • Implement design specifications in software applications
  • Utilize software configuration management tools for version control
  • Collaborate within a team and independently to meet project goals
  • Adapt to changing priorities in a fast-paced development environment

Benefits

  • Opportunity to work on programs of national significance
  • Access to advanced technologies and solutions
  • Collaborative work environment with a team of highly cleared specialists
  • Potential for skill development in cutting-edge fields such as AI and biometrics
Full Job Description
We are looking for Windows Application Developers to join potential work for an upcoming program our Partner is pursuing.

Requirements
  • TS/SCI FSP Clearance
  • 3 years of experience in each of the following: developing, testing, and debugging in C, C++, and Python
  • 3 years of demonstrated in-depth experience developing, testing, and debugging software for Windows OS using Visual Studio IDE and Windows SDK
  • Demonstrated in-depth understanding of Windows low level systems development and API
  • 3 years of professional software development experience, including design implementation, testing, analysis, and debugging
  • Demonstrated experience using software configuration management tools (e.g. Git)
  • Software systems development experience and understanding of OS internals in at least one of the following: BSD/Linux/Unix, Windows, Mac OS, Android, RISC assembly
Desired Skills
  • Minimum of 3 years of experience in developing and testing apps on one of the following platforms: Windows, Mac, Linux, Mobile, or Embedded platforms
  • Ability to RE code
  • Ability to work independently and as part of teams, in a fast-paced development environment with constant changing priorities
  • An undergraduate or graduate degree or certifications in a relevant technical field
  • Demonstrated experience utilizing a diversity of development languages
  • In-depth understanding and/or implementation of CNE techniques and methodologies, to include application and mitigation techniques for one of the following: BSD/Linux/Unix. Windows, Mac OS, Android, RISC assembly
  • Demonstrated experience applying continuous integration and automated testing tools to software development practices
  • Demonstrated experience with firewalls, standard operating systems features, and PSPs

About Us
For more than 20 years, NewGen Technologies has solved our clients' toughest IT challenges with integrity, security, and outstanding service by delivering both technology and talent. We have helped secure borders, have used artificial intelligence (AI) to fight terror, aided the identification of criminals, and have helped to prevent crime through the introduction of biometrics. Our team of Highly Cleared Specialists have hard-to-find skills and expertise in a wide spectrum of technologies to provide solutions that transform business processes and solve problems of national significance. #CJ

Similar Jobs

More Jobs at NewGen

More Information Technology Jobs

Find similar Windows Application Developer jobs: